The VERMONT GAGE 112118980 is a Class ZZ Plus plug gage designed for dimensional inspection of machined bores and holes with a nominal diameter of 18.98 mm. Built from tool steel with a 10 micro-inch coating finish, this gage delivers a tolerance of 0.00508 mm, meeting the precision demands required for Go inspection work. Each unit ships with a Certificate of Accuracy traceable to NIST standards and conforms to ASME B89.1. Machinists, quality control technicians, and metrology professionals rely on this type of gage for reliable, repeatable measurement verification on the shop floor or in a calibration lab.
This plug gage is suited for Go inspection of workpiece bores in manufacturing and machining environments. It is compatible with use alongside set micrometers, verniers, and other precision measuring devices where bore conformance must be verified to tight tolerances. Typical applications include incoming inspection, in-process quality checks, and final inspection of components requiring controlled hole sizing. The overall length of 2.0000 inches makes it practical for standard bench and hand-held inspection setups. The gage is appropriate for both production floor use and controlled metrology environments where NIST-traceable documentation is required.

Plug gages of this type are handled and used by quality control technicians and machinists trained in precision metrology. Handle with clean, dry hands or lint-free gloves to prevent corrosion and dimensional contamination from skin oils. Store the gage in its case when not in use and allow it to reach ambient room temperature before taking measurements to avoid thermal expansion errors. Periodic recalibration should be performed in accordance with your facility quality management procedures and applicable ASME standards.
